Which tabs broke? The rear two are tricky because you need to insert the slots in at an angle and then swing it up to the windshield, but I haven't had any issues with the forward two.
Front two snapped on insertion. One back tab separated.
2nd new attempt I went super duper slow and it was all fine. Feel like the original glare shield was hyper brittle. Newer one was a bit better. 17700 VIN

It's true, you can mostly clean the glass with a microfiber on a thin device like a card (or, a spatula hahaha). It's efficient, but not as thorough, and doesn't allow cleaning of the lenses.
